Planning appeal decision

Notice varied and upheld26 October 20233313363

Land at Greenclose also known as Lower Parklands, Wangfield Lane, Curdridge, SOUTHAMPTON, Hampshire, SO32 2DA

without planning permission the occupation of the dwelling Greenclose by a person who does not meet the requirements of condition 3 of application 86/01902/OLD which states: "The occupation of the dwelling shall be limited to a person solely or mainly employed, or last employed, in the locality in agriculture as defined in Section 290 (1) of the Town and Country Planning Act 1971, or in forestry (including any dependents of such persons residing with him) or a widow or widower of such a person

Authority
Winchester City Council
Appeal type
enforcement · Enforcement Notice
Procedure
Written Representations
Development
agricultural · Other minor developments
Inspector
Hawkins S

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• Whether it was too late to take enforcement action against the breach of planning control (ground d)
  • Whether it has been shown that the dwelling is no longer needed for agriculture or forestry in the locality (ground a)

What decided it

The appellant failed to demonstrate that there is no continuing need for residential accommodation for agricultural or forestry workers in the locality, as required by Policy DM11.

Plan policies cited: Policy DM11, Policy MTRA 4
